Transaction 2dd68aca2a0254d56be5390bb113d981af5aa77287790f934549effd54454309
1 Input
1 Output
-
2dd68aca2a0254d56be5390bb113d981af5aa77287790f934549effd54454309:0
- value
- 58638
- script pubkey
- OP_0 OP_PUSHBYTES_20 95a62f91d62ac13cecf348564d74727725ce06e2
- address
- bc1qjknzlywk9tqnem8nfpty6arjwujuuphz53vvp5